Does the job for not much cost
From a bewildering selection of electric blankets with a massive price range I chose those rather basic one. It has all the functions I needed - to prewarm a bed before getting in. And it does it well. On the highest (of 3) setting the bed is warm in about 30 minutes. I don't leave it on all night. It does not have a timer or dual control as I don't need that. It works just fine. The corner connector is not unduly obtrusive and can be left just under the pillow. The blanket covers most of the mattress (unlike some) and has full width straps rather than those pathetic corner straps which never stay on. One star off because I've noted than the blanket can move around slightly but that's it. Good blanket at a good price (so if it needs replacing it won't break the bank).

Review After Four Years of Use
The media could not be loaded. I bought this in late 2020, so it’s now heading into its fifth winter. I chose it based on the well-known brand name, good reviews, and reasonable price.First impressions were that it’s well made with an overall cotton type feeling of reasonable quality, in a simple, neutral colour. I did notice that it doesn’t fully cover the size of the single mattress. I measured it at about 135 cm/4’5” in length, and about 72 cm/2’4” wide. The heating element wires stop about 5 inches from the edge of the material each side, so it effectively has an unheated border. To be fair, the specifications do mention that the blanket isn’t meant to reach the edges to enable it to lie flat, so I’ll accept it’s intended to be this way.The power cable has an overall length of about 8 feet with the controller nearer to the edge of the blanket. It doesn’t have a timer or any bells and whistles, just nice and simple heat options:0 = Off1 = Warm - 12 W2 = Warmer - 23 W3 = Warmest - 40 WNote: These wattage figures are for the single size blanket.An orange light on the controller glows very softly when switched on.It’s quite slow to fully warm up; I always switch it on at least half an hour before bedtime, on No.3 heat, which is warm enough for a cosy bed.The heating wires do protrude somewhat through the fabric, so some people may find that uncomfortable. This could also be the case across other brands as well, and I personally found I got used to it pretty quickly, without affecting my sleep quality.The elastic straps are helpful, keeping it in place quite securely under the mattress.-Pros: • Well known, trusted brand • Reasonable price • User-friendly controls • Well made, good quality, light weight • No unpleasant smell • Reliability: Still working fine after four years • Low running cost-Cons: • Heating wires can be felt while lying on it • Does not entirely cover the mattress • Slow to heat up • Limited maximum heat levelOverall, this is a good, reliable product, and I have not had any problems with it over the past four years of use.
